AN ADRENALIN-CHARGED F1 WEEKEND AT SWISSÔTEL THE STAMFORD, SINGAPORE
SINGAPORE, 7 October 2008 – It was an exhilarating F1 weekend at Swissôtel The Stamford, which was in the thick of the action at Singapore’s inaugural 2008 FORMULA 1™ SingTel Singapore Grand Prix.

Towering at 226 metres and 72 storeys high, Singapore’s tallest trackside hotel served no less than 30,000 outside catering meals, 15,000 in-house guests and gave away some 7,500 commemorative F1 amenities over the three days.
In its review of the Singapore Grand Prix, Singapore’s main local daily The Straits Times remarked, “Service standards of staff at trackside hotels like Swissôtel The Stamford, food and beverage and merchandise outlets around the circuit were praised”.
Swissôtel The Stamford’s strategic location in the heart of the world’s first night street circuit provided guests with a myriad of superb vantage points from its luxurious guest rooms and food & beverage outlets, boasting the most extensive views of the Formula One racetrack all round.
The hotel was abuzz with activity as it housed sponsors and teams from BMW Sauber, Ferrari and Honda, and played host to numerous VIPs and dignitaries during the F1 season. It staged numerous stellar corporate events and activities, which saw top international celebrities and world-class Formula One drivers such as Kimi Räikkönen, Felipe Massa, Mark Webber, Sebastian Vettel, Nick Heidfeld and Robert Kubica, walk through its doors. The BMW Sauber F1.07 racecar displayed at the lobby was a favourite photo-spot, captivating both passers-by and guests within the hotel.
Hotel guests enjoyed special collectible F1 amenities which they could take home as souvenirs after the race. Earplug sets were placed in every room, whilst guests at track-facing rooms and suites were given a set of binoculars and treated to racecar chocolates as part of their turndown service. More than 7,500 of these commemorative F1 items were given out during the F1 weekend, leaving guests with a memorable F1 experience at Swissôtel The Stamford.
Diners and partygoers revelled in the F1 fever and caught a piece of the action at Equinox, an integrated F&B complex situated from levels 69 to 72 of the hotel. Window seats at the Equinox Restaurant were fully occupied by guests, who paid a premium to enjoy the spectacular views of the racetrack. Fine-dining French restaurant Jaan, was booked by high profile corporate clients for private functions on all three days of the F1 weekend.
The newly revamped New Asia was packed with revellers epitomising the glitz and glamour of Formula One, sipping on more than 5,000 glasses of premium champagnes, fine wines and signature cocktails whilst watching the race from the bar’s floor-to-ceiling glass windows. The sleek nightspot also hosted a dynamic fashion show by an American apparel brand renowned for its unique, colourful and artistic creations. International models, specially flown in for the event, strutted down the runway in cutting-edge togs at the stroke of midnight on the first day of the F1 season.
